    Speaking of Verdicchio

    Since we're speaking of Verdicchio we must also be speaking of Lugana. Ottella's 2015 "Molceo" Lugana Riserva is another recent moderately priced Italian that really delivers the goods. It smells like a seaside homestead with aromas of citrus peel, straw, ocean spray, wet slate, and smoke...
